Now Accepting Applications for New Executive Director

GOLDEN, CO – The Golden Civic Foundation (Foundation) has launched its search for a new executive director as the current director, Heather Schneider (Schneider), will be winding down her service through the end of 2023 with the intention of having a smooth transition to new leadership. The Golden Civic Foundation Board has established a selection committee of board members who will interview and choose the organization’s next executive director. A link to the job description can be found below and applications are due by 5pm on Friday, August 18, 2023.

In 2016, Schneider was hired to lead the Foundation as its Executive Director. Under Schneider’s leadership, the non-profit has diversified and increased their revenue by over 170% which has allowed the Foundation to grow and increase its impact to the Golden community via their Community Grant Programs and Small Business Loan Program. The Foundation also served in a key leadership role with Golden’s community leaders to identify and implement ways to respond to the economic uncertainty during the pandemic. This resulted in the Foundation providing $130,000 low interest loans to Golden’s small businesses and over $105,000 in grants to support the Golden community during this time. Lastly, together with a team of community stakeholders, the Foundation played a key role in helping Miners Alley Playhouse acquire the Meyer Hardware building for their future Performing Arts Center.
